How to get from Potomac Festival After Omniride to Ocean City by bus and train?
By bus and train
To get from Potomac Festival After Omniride to Ocean City in Washington, D.C. - Baltimore, MD, you’ll need to take one bus line and one train line: take the WOODLOC bus from Potomac Festival After Omniride station to Woodbridge Vre Station Departures station. Next, you’ll have to switch to the NORTHEAST REGIONAL train and finally take the AMTRAK THRUWAY CONNECTING SERVICE from Bwi Thurgood Marshall Airport, Md station to Ocm station. The total trip duration for this route is approximately 6 hr 54 min.
